Karis Haewon Ryu | 류혜원 is a writer from many places. She grew up across North America and the Pacific as a U.S. military dependent of Korean descent, and her experiences inspire the stories she writes. She is deeply interested in how worlds get made, and in examining what/whose narratives hold the appearance of universality. She is currently based in New Haven, CT, where she is pursuing a PhD in Religious Studies at Yale University. She is working on her first novel with the support of Tin House and StoryStudio Chicago.
